I'm 22, clean license, etc and 2 years NCB.

Usually i have been paying £120 p/m on average since i was 19 on a 20vt Coupe.

It went down to £113 p/m last year, and my renewal came through for £99 p/m this year. (£1188 for the year)

I thought i would try and compare some meerkats this time, and to my surprise i got a quote for £729 for the year which i thought was good.

I phoned "Bell" my current insurer and explained my findings. Not only did they do everything they could to stop me canceling my policy. They beat the other deal i got and offered me 12 months car insurance for £639!

Now i know paying monthly increases your insurance cost, but i'm sure it doesn't double it!

I can now spend my savings on the Coupe laugh
